Understanding Anthurium Needs

The Plant’s Basics

Anthuriums are tropical plants native to Central and South America. They thrive in warm, humid environments and are known for their glossy, heart-shaped leaves and vibrant flowers. To flourish, Anthuriums require proper care, including suitable light, humidity, and nutrition. They are sensitive to overwatering and require a balanced approach to fertilization to achieve optimal growth and flowering.

Fertilization and Blooming

Fertilization plays a crucial role in the health and blooming of Anthuriums. These plants benefit from regular feeding to replenish the nutrients that are depleted from the soil over time. A balanced fertilizer, typically with equal parts n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ium (NPK), supports overall plant health and encourages prolific blooming.

Potential Pitfalls and Solutions

Over-Fertilization

While the one-cup solution is generally effective, there is a risk of over-fertilization if not applied correctly. Excessive nutrients can lead to leaf burn or inhibit flowering. To avoid this, start with a diluted solution and gradually increase concentration if necessary. Always follow the recommended dosage on the fertilizer package.

Soil Quality

Poor soil quality can affect the effectiveness of fertilization. Ensure that your Anthurium is planted in well-draining soil that is rich in organic matter. Consider repotting your plant if the soil becomes compacted or depleted of nutrients.

Environmental Factors

Remember that fertilization alone won’t guarantee blooms if other conditions are not met. Ensure your Anthurium is placed in an appropriate location with adequate light and humidity. Address any pest issues or environmental stresses that may affect plant health.

Additional Tips for Anthurium Care

Light Requirements

Anthuriums prefer bright, indirect light. Too much direct sunlight can scorch the leaves, while too little light can result in poor blooming. Find a balance by placing your plant near a window with filtered light.

Humidity

High humidity levels are ideal for Anthuriums. If your indoor environment is dry, consider using a humidifier or placing a tray of water near the plant to increase moisture levels.

Temperature

Maintain a consistent temperature between 65-80°F (18-27°C). Avoid exposing the plant to cold drafts or sudden temperature changes, as these can stress the plant and impact blooming.
